irregular verbs |
lmust be memorized, 300 verbs do not follow this regular pattern |
|
irregular verb that stay the same |
bet burst cast cost fit hit put quit rid set shut |
|
irregular verb- past & past participle are same |
bring brought build built buy bought catch caught cling clung dig dug fling flung lay (to place) laid lose lost sneak snuck sit sat |
|
irregular verb, past participle is different from the past |
begin began begun bite bit bitten break broke broken do did done drink drank drunk eat ate eaten fly flew flown grow grew grown know knew known lie (recline) lay lain see saw seen show showed shown wear wore worn |
